How to know if HD2 is 1024MB.


image via Smartphone Deals



According to my knowledge, there are 2 types of HD2s.
  • European HD2 w/512MB of memory.
  • US T-Mobile HD2 w/1024MB.
For all the guides here at ZAP4 dealing with the HD2, you must have the US T-Mobile 1024MB version of the HD2.


TO CHECK WHICH HD2 YOU HAVE


According to this post at XDA, if you have a green call button and a red end button (like in the picture above) then you have the US T-Mobile 1024MB HD2. The European 512MB HD2, supposedly, has all white buttons.
